Straight‑sided Büchner funnels with fixed perforated plate for efficient vacuum filtration of suspensions.
Glazed porcelain construction provides high chemical and thermal resistance for repeated filtration cycles.
Wide diameter range from 35 to 300 mm, covering small‑scale tests up to pilot or QC filtrations.
Porcelain Büchner funnel designed for vacuum or gravity filtration processes to separate solid and liquid phases efficiently. The fixed perforated plate supports the filter paper and promotes uniform flow, reducing channeling and improving throughput. Glazed porcelain ensures excellent chemical and thermal resistance, making it suitable for routine use in chemistry, R&D and QC laboratories. The broad range of diameters allows users to match filtration area to sample volume and process needs. For laboratory use only. Technical features
Type: Straight‑sided Büchner funnel with fixed perforated plate Material: Glazed porcelain Function: Vacuum or gravity filtration for solid/liquid separation Filtration surface: Integrated perforated plate (use with filter paper, not supplied) Filter paper: Optimal use indicated with filter papers around 11–11.5 cm diameter (to be adapted to funnel size) Recommended use: With Büchner flask, Büchner ring and appropriate sintered joints Packaging: Sold individually (single unit) Typical applications: Chemistry, pharmaceuticals, quality control, environmental testing, education |
